Hmm, interesting. Clone price, but only a clone for a turn if used that way. Copying planeswalkers is interesting - but won't the legend rule kick in? Assuming not then it's a slow way to be a second terrifying thing. The ultimate is also terrifying, and kinda quick to kick in.

This goes right on to my pile of "why all planeswalkers must die" and is thankfully relatively easy to kill. So pretty much perfect, I guess.

3 turns of delay isn't that quick for an ultimate; many PWs' ultimates fire off after only 2 turns' delay, like Garruk Wildspeaker or Sarkhan Vol.

But yes, it would get legend-ruled as a planeswalker (that is, if it's your own planeswalker it's copying). It'd need to say "except he's still a Rei" or "his type is still Rei", like Imnamon, Copycat did.

Yeah, unfortunately with that text it gets a bit ant-like. At least this way he can either clone himself or an opponents walker.
